Let's say that you want to monitor the total packets received by an SNMP device whose IP address is 192.72.24.1.
Then you would like to save this value every 60 seconds between 9:00 AM and 5:00 PM. And if the rate is greater
than 1000 per second, you want to save the value and at the same time be informed of the situation through an
audible alarm, such as a beep. Suppose you consider this as a critical condition and would like to call it "Hot_1."

Beep – an audible alarm issued by the network management station
Show message box – display a user-defined message in a box on the
network management station's screen. The message box appears on top of
all other windows. When the message box appears, you must click on the
<OK> button to dismiss the message. This action is recommended for
critical events.
Run program – execute any Windows-based application. This action is
ideal for sending a message via email or FAX.
Send message to REPORT – Insert a message into the Report window.
Alarm messages are time stamped and shown in chronological order. This
action is recommended for routine events.
Write into database – Put a message into the event database.
